Summary
Overview
Work History
Education
Skills
Websites
Interests
References
Timeline
Generic
Owen Kamau

Owen Kamau

Front-end developer
Nairobi,Kenya

Summary

Experienced frontend developer skilled in creating web and mobile applications. Known for delivering innovative, user-focused solutions and collaborating effectively with diverse teams. Proficient in ReactJS and React-Native, consistently producing high-quality code to improve user interactions. Excited to contribute technical expertise and teamwork to a frontend developer role.

Overview

8
8
years of professional experience
1
1
Language

Work History

Freelance Frontend & Mobile Developer

Freelance Services
Nairobi, Kenya
09.2024 - Current
  • Enhanced user experience by designing and implementing intuitive mobile applications for iOS and Android platforms.
  • Design UX/UI to translate wireframes into functional prototypes, ensuring consistent visual design across all platform versions.
  • Evaluated emerging technologies and trends, leveraging AI code generation for faster mobile development on client projects, while meticulously reviewing AI-generated code to ensure security, quality, and thorough documentation.
  • Collaborated with cross-functional teams to develop innovative solutions for complex client requirements.
  • Optimizing web performance for ecommerce sites, reducing load times, and using CDNs for image optimization.

Front-end Developer

Nile capital
, Kenya
01.2022 - 04.2024
  • Company Overview: pesabase.com
  • Developed interactive user interfaces using ReactJS and React Native, enhancing user engagement by 15% and improving application usability.
  • Designed and updated layouts to meet usability and performance requirements.
  • Translated designs and wireframes into high-quality code, reducing development time by days and increasing project delivery efficiency.
  • Utilized the Expo toolchain for React Native development, accelerating the deployment process by 20% and streamlining mobile application updates.
  • Implemented responsive designs, ensuring cross-browser compatibility and achieving a 90% user satisfaction rate across various devices.
  • Identified performance bottlenecks and optimized ReactJS and React Native applications, improving load times by 15% and boosting application performance.
  • Managed application state using Redux.
  • Contributed to projects within Scrum project management environments.

Front-end Developer

Ongair
Nairobi, Kenya
11.2018 - 05.2022
  • Developed new features in ReactJS resulting in seamless integration with server-side logic in Ruby on Rails.
  • Designed, built, and maintained Ruby and ReactJS codebases leading to robust and scalable application architecture.
  • Integrated data storage solutions using MySQL achieving efficient and reliable data management.
  • Implemented a responsive UI with ReactJS enhancing overall user experience.
  • Collaborated with back-end developers to improve website functionality and integrate new features.
  • Troubleshot technical issues related to front end development, ensuring prompt resolution to maintain project timelines.
  • Coded using HTML, CSS, and JavaScript to develop features for desktop platforms.

Front-end Developer

Touch Inspiration
, Kenya
08.2018 - 12.2020
  • Company Overview: touchinspiration.com
  • Developed mobile applications, websites, and landing pages from concept through deployment, resulting in streamlined project execution and enhanced client satisfaction.
  • Assessed UX and UI designs for technical feasibility, collaborating effectively with product teams and backend developers to ensure seamless implementation and user experience.
  • Leveraged REST APIs for integrations in both mobile and web applications, enhancing functionality and improving data consistency across platforms.
  • Implemented responsive and smooth UI across mobile and web applications, significantly improving user engagement and overall application performance.
  • Utilized HTML, CSS, and JavaScript, ReactJS, React-Native to create visually appealing and responsive web pages that met client requirements.

Internship

Moringa School
, Kenya
05.2017 - 09.2017
  • Company Overview: moringaschool.com
  • Collaborated with curriculum designers to create new learning content, enhancing educational materials.
  • Conducted stand-ups and performed code reviews in JavaScript and Ruby, improving code quality and team collaboration.
  • Implemented standard requirements for student projects, ensuring consistency and quality across submissions.
  • Created part of the learning content, impacting over 100+ students with improved educational resources.
  • Technologies - Javascript, ReactJS, Ruby, Ruby on Rails.
  • Contributed to a positive team environment by collaborating with fellow interns on group projects and presentations.

Education

Moringa School - Javascript specialization

Moringa School
12.2016 - 2017.05

Skills

  • Javascript

  • Team collaboration

  • Problem-solving

  • Agile development methodologies

  • Git

  • Firebase

  • Restful API

  • Redux

  • Sass

  • React Native

  • ReactJS

  • Javascript

Interests

Hiking, Road trips, Drawing, Learning new technologies

References

Mr. Julius

Technical Mentor, Java, web3, blockchain Developer
Tel: (+254) 765-064-126

Email: kariukijulius63@gmail.com

Mr. Charles
Back-End Developer, E-Kitabu
Tel: (+254) 707-426-160
Email: kakaicharles92@gmail.com

Timeline

Freelance Frontend & Mobile Developer

Freelance Services
09.2024 - Current

Front-end Developer

Nile capital
01.2022 - 04.2024

Front-end Developer

Ongair
11.2018 - 05.2022

Front-end Developer

Touch Inspiration
08.2018 - 12.2020

Internship

Moringa School
05.2017 - 09.2017

Moringa School - Javascript specialization

Moringa School
12.2016 - 2017.05
Owen KamauFront-end developer